Head to head by decade

Decade Central African Republic Ecuador Difference Ahead
1980s 0 deaths 0 deaths 0 deaths
1990s 0 deaths 1.1 deaths 1.1 deaths Ecuador
2000s 92.5 deaths 10.9 deaths 81.6 deaths Central African Republic
2010s 1,145 deaths 1.1 deaths 1,144 deaths Central African Republic
2020s 466.86 deaths 222.71 deaths 244.14 deaths Central African Republic

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
